HOST: Welcome to our podcast, today we're talking with an expert in the field of education about a course that focuses on developing school-wide response plans for substance abuse. Can you tell us a bit more about this Postgraduate Certificate? GUEST: Absolutely, this course is designed to equip educators and school leaders with the skills and knowledge they need to effectively address substance abuse issues in schools. It covers evidence-based practices, policy development, and student support services. HOST: That sounds like a comprehensive approach. Can you share any personal experiences or insights related to the importance of having a school-wide response plan for substance abuse? GUEST: Sure, I've seen firsthand how substance abuse can impact students and their families. Having a well-thought-out plan in place can make a huge difference in early intervention, crisis management, and family engagement. HOST: I can imagine. Are there any current industry trends or challenges that you'd like to highlight in relation to this course topic? GUEST: One trend we're seeing is a greater emphasis on holistic, prevention-focused approaches to substance abuse. A challenge is ensuring that all school staff are properly trained and equipped to implement these strategies. HOST: That's a great point. Looking to the future, how do you see this area of education and prevention evolving? GUEST: I believe we'll continue to see a shift towards more proactive, community-based approaches to substance abuse prevention. It's an exciting time to be working in this field.
